It might seem that Hastings & St Leonards Sailing Club had packed up and gone home for the season, as there has been no racing for seven weeks, but this was because every Sunday for that period of time, we have had rough weather!

On our last weekend of the season, we were at last able to get onto the water for the Mulled Wine Handicap.

The wind was coming from various directions from north-east to west-north-west at force 4 gusting to force 5 at times. This made for a few capsizes in the cooling sea.

As the weather had started to cool only seven Lasers, one Miracle and a Topper were racing.

Race 1 got underway with Tom Richardson leading from Melanie Clark with Roy Sandford in 3rd. they continued in this order to the last lap where Steve Phillips went into 3rd following Sandford’s capsize, who finished 4th.

In race 2 Richardson lead the way again, this time from Sandford with Phillips in 3rd. On lap 2 Clark who had a bad start, managed to make good her deficit into 3rd position. At the end of lap 3 Richardson again finished 1st from Sandford with Clark in 3rd.
